package com.sun.jersey.samples.storageservice;
import com.webcohesion.enunciate.metadata.Ignore;
import java.io.BufferedInputStream;
import java.io.ByteArrayOutputStream;
import java.io.FileInputStream;
import java.io.IOException;
import java.io.InputStream;
import java.io.OutputStream;
import java.net.HttpURLConnection;
import java.net.URL;
/**
*
* @author Paul.Sandoz@Sun.Com
*/
@Ignore
public class Main {
public static void main(String[] args) throws Exception {
if (args.length == 2) {
// <"GET" | "DELETE" | "PUT"> <URI>
String uri = args[1];
if (args[0].equalsIgnoreCase("GET")) {
// Collection operations
// Get all collections
byte[] content = get(uri);
System.out.println(new String(content));
} else if (args[0].equalsIgnoreCase("DELETE")) {
// Collection operation
// Delete a collection
delete(uri);
} else if (args[0].equalsIgnoreCase("PUT")) {
// Collection operation
// Create a collection (if not already created)
put(uri);
} else {
throw new IllegalArgumentException();
}
} else if (args.length == 3) {
// PUT <URI> <mediaType>
String uri = args[1];
if (args[0].equalsIgnoreCase("PUT")) {
// Item operation
// Create an item, or update if already created
put(uri, args[2], new BufferedInputStream(System.in));
} else if (args[0].equalsIgnoreCase("POST")) {
post(uri, args[2], new BufferedInputStream(System.in));
} else {
throw new IllegalArgumentException();
}
} else if (args.length == 4) {
// PUT <URI> <mediaType> <file>
String uri = args[1];
if (args[0].equalsIgnoreCase("PUT")) {
// Item operation
// Create an item, or update if already created
put(uri, args[2], new BufferedInputStream(new FileInputStream(args[3])));
} else if (args[0].equalsIgnoreCase("POST")) {
post(uri, args[2], new BufferedInputStream(new FileInputStream(args[3])));
} else {
throw new IllegalArgumentException();
}
} else {
throw new IllegalArgumentException();
}
}
private void printUsage() {
}
private static byte[] get(String uri) throws IOException {
URL u = new URL(uri);
HttpURLConnection uc = (HttpURLConnection)u.openConnection();
uc.setRequestMethod("GET");
int status = uc.getResponseCode();
String mediaType = uc.getContentType();
InputStream in = uc.getInputStream();
ByteArrayOutputStream baos = new ByteArrayOutputStream();
byte[] buffer = new byte[1024];
int r;
while ((r = in.read(buffer)) != -1) {
baos.write(buffer, 0, r);
}
return baos.toByteArray();
}
private static void put(String uri) throws IOException {
URL u = new URL(uri);
HttpURLConnection uc = (HttpURLConnection)u.openConnection();
uc.setRequestMethod("PUT");
int status = uc.getResponseCode();
System.out.println("Status: " + status);
}
private static void put(String uri, String mediaType, InputStream in) throws IOException {
URL u = new URL(uri);
HttpURLConnection uc = (HttpURLConnection)u.openConnection();
uc.setRequestMethod("PUT");
uc.setRequestProperty("Content-Type", mediaType);
uc.setDoOutput(true);
OutputStream out = uc.getOutputStream();
byte[] data = new byte[2048];
int read;
while ((read = in.read(data)) != -1)
out.write(data, 0, read);
out.close();
int status = uc.getResponseCode();
System.out.println("Status: " + status);
}
private static void post(String uri, String mediaType, InputStream in) throws IOException {
URL u = new URL(uri);
HttpURLConnection uc = (HttpURLConnection)u.openConnection();
uc.setRequestMethod("POST");
uc.setRequestProperty("Content-Type", mediaType);
uc.setDoOutput(true);
OutputStream out = uc.getOutputStream();
byte[] data = new byte[2048];
int read;
while ((read = in.read(data)) != -1)
out.write(data, 0, read);
out.close();
int status = uc.getResponseCode();
System.out.println("Status: " + status);
}
private static void delete(String uri) throws IOException {
URL u = new URL(uri);
HttpURLConnection uc = (HttpURLConnection)u.openConnection();
uc.setRequestMethod("DELETE");
int status = uc.getResponseCode();
System.out.println("Status: " + status);
}
}
